On Oct. 5, GISELLE, WINTER, KARINA, and NINGNING of aespa launched their first EP, Savage. The band initially debuted with SM Leisure in 2020 with a single known as “Black Mamba,” and aespa dropped a second single known as “Next Level” in Might 2021. The Ok-pop group‘s debut EP Savage reached No. 20 on the Billboard 200, setting a brand new report on the chart.

Whereas aespa initially debuted with a single known as “Black Mamba,” Savage is taken into account one other debut physique of labor by the Ok-pop group as a result of it’s the group’s first EP and bodily album.
Savage has six tracks: “Aenergy,” “Savage,” “I’ll Make You Cry,” “Yeppi Yeppi,” “Iconic,” and “Lucid Dream.”

When the group debuted with the single “Black Mamba” in 2020, the track’s music video turned the most-viewed debut Ok-pop music video inside the first 24 hours and the quickest debut Ok-pop music video to surpass 100 million views.
aespa adopted “Black Mamba” with a single known as “Next Level.” In line with a press launch, the “Next Level” music video “surpassed 50 million views on YouTube within 3 days, 10 hours and 20 minutes of release.”
The Ok-pop group broke this report when the “Savage” music video achieved 50 million views on YouTube inside two days, displaying how a lot aespa’s fan base has grown.
